JJ GARFINKELThe imagery for my paintings on thin sheets of aluminum is derived from 18th century Rococo sources; namely, the French painters Watteau, Fragonard, Boucher and Lancret. Watteau used most of his figures as 'stock footage'~ a limited cast of characters appears continuously in his body of work, their slightly shifted poses and contexts made to seem endlessly unique. I continue to explore these pre-cinematic techniques and introduce a similar cast of characters into dramatically altered environments. Ultimately I have found a surrogate for my own life experiences. The 18th century fascination for decadence and romance, and the political implications of these obsessions, remains a relevant, ongoing cultural narrative.

The smooth surface, neutral grey color and industrial aspect of the aluminum are very appealing to me; and my process of applying oil paint to such a surface has been predetermined by these qualities. Reflection, absorption and luminosity are all elements I use to enhance specific imagery.
